System Notifications signup:
Users are now able to manage their own system notification subscription preferences from their ‘My Details’ screen. They can nominate which, if any, of the following notification types they would like to receive:
- System Notification
- Feature Notifications
- UAT Invitations.
Single Sign-on:
- For companies using enterprise identity providers (e.g. Azure AD), ConSol can now be configured to allow Single-Sign-On, to both simplify the user experience and take advantage of more stringent security controls.
- Each company will have a specific icon on the login page to identify that access for their users may be subject to company Federation rules.
- Federation can be enforced (default) for all users within the company. Users requiring additional logins linked to the same verification email address will have these logins treated as un-federated and will follow the existing security access rules.
- Any companies wishing to utilise the new Single Sign-on functionality should contact our Support team for information on how to proceed. Depending on the Identity store being used, implementation and configuration costs may be incurred.
- Once the functionality is enabled, the SSO-enabled flag on the user management screens will control federated access for each user.
